What Causes This Problem
- Fires, whether small or large, can leave behind soot residue.
- Candle use can lead to significant soot accumulation.
- Malfunctioning HVAC systems can distribute soot indoors.
- Improper ventilation during cooking can cause soot buildup.

How Long Does Soot Cleanup Usually Take?
The duration for soot cleanup can vary based on the damage extent, generally taking an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days.
What Can I Do Before Help Arrives?
Minimize movement around the affected area and avoid using any heating or cooling systems until professionals can assess the situation.
Is Soot Damage Covered by Insurance?
In many cases, soot damage may be covered by homeowners’ insurance policies, so check your policy for specific details.
Can I Clean Up Soot Myself?
While some minor soot can be cleaned, professional help is highly recommended to prevent further damage and ensure thorough removal.
